Metasploit Tool Overview

Metasploit is not just your average cybersecurity tool; it's a comprehensive framework designed for penetration testing, vulnerability assessment, and exploit development. Developed by Rapid7, Metasploit provides security professionals with a robust set of tools and resources to simulate cyber attacks and identify potential weaknesses in a system's defenses.

With Metasploit, users can perform a wide range of security tasks, including network discovery, vulnerability scanning, and payload generation. Its modular architecture allows for flexibility and customization, making it suitable for both beginners and advanced users in the cybersecurity field.

Penetration Testing with Metasploit

One of the primary uses of Metasploit is in conducting penetration tests, also known as ethical hacking. Penetration testing involves simulating cyber attacks on a system or network to identify vulnerabilities and assess its overall security posture. Metasploit's vast arsenal of exploits, payloads, and auxiliary modules makes it an indispensable tool for penetration testers.

With Metasploit, security professionals can simulate various attack scenarios, such as remote code execution, privilege escalation, and SQL injection, among others. By emulating real-world attack techniques, penetration testers can provide organizations with actionable insights into their security weaknesses and recommendations for mitigation.

Community Collaboration and Knowledge Sharing

One of the most significant strengths of Metasploit lies in its vibrant and diverse community of users and contributors. The Metasploit Framework is open-source, meaning that anyone can access, modify, and contribute to its development. This collaborative approach fosters innovation and enables rapid responses to emerging threats.

Through forums, mailing lists, and community events, users can share their experiences, exchange ideas, and collaborate on improving Metasploit's capabilities. This collective effort ensures that Metasploit remains a cutting-edge tool for cybersecurity professionals worldwide, capable of adapting to evolving threats and challenges.
